Energy Efficiency

Pellet stoves can provide homeowners with energy efficiency and control, a clean and natural alternative to traditional oil, propane or electric resistance heaters. These sturdy stoves use compressed pellet fuel made from ground, dried wood or other biomass to produce consistent heat over extended periods. They can be utilized in conjunction with existing heating systems, or as the main source of heat, based on home size and heating needs.

Additionally There are many states and localities that offer rebates for efficient pellet stoves, which makes them a cost-effective heating option. These incentives, combined with low operating costs and minimal maintenance, make pellet stoves a great choice for anyone who wants to cut the energy costs of their home.

Easy Maintenance

Pellet stoves are simple to use and don't require as much maintenance as wood stoves or other heating options. However, you'll need to maintain your stove to ensure it is operating properly throughout the winter. A pellet stove operates by supplying fuel in the form of small pellets to an electric auger that is fed the pellets into a burning chamber called a burn pot where they are burned to create heat. The burn pot as well as the hopper are shielded from overheating to keep the stove efficient and safe. Some pellet stoves feature an automatic ignition system, power modulation, and an exhaust fan built-in.

Most pellet stoves vs wood stoves stoves are designed to make use of only top-quality wood pellets made from sawdust, wood chips, bark and other natural materials. The pellets should also contain a low amount of moisture so that they don't burn too fast and producing excessive smoke and ash. Many of the most well-known stoves can store large quantities and provide heat to a complete home. Certain pellet stoves have smaller hoppers which only require refilling once a day. Certain models require an electric auger to work, so they won't function without electricity or backup batteries. If you choose one that requires an electric auger, it's important to buy backup batteries so you can continue to use your stove in the event of a power outage.
